Eastern Bankshares, Inc. (NASDAQ:EBC – Get Free Report) was the recipient of a large increase in short interest in February. As of February 28th, there was short interest totalling 5,200,000 shares, an increase of 19.5% from the February 13th total of 4,350,000 shares. Currently, 2.5% of the shares of the company are short sold. Based on an average daily volume of 1,000,000 shares, the short-interest ratio is presently 5.2 days.

About Eastern Bankshares
Eastern Bankshares, Inc operates as the bank holding company for Eastern Bank that provides banking products and services primarily to retail, commercial, and small business customers. The company provides deposit accounts, interest checking accounts, money market accounts, savings accounts, and time certificates of deposit accounts.
